Working principle:
1.The magnetic powder clutch is a new type of transmission that uses magnetic powder as a medium to form a magnetic powder chain to transmit torque under energization.
2.It is mainly composed of inner rotor, outer rotor, excitation line diagram and magnetic powder.
3.When the coil is not energized, the active rotor rotates.
4. Due to the centrifugal force, the magnetic powder is clamped on the inner wall of the active rotor, and there is no contact between the magnetic powder and the driven rotor, and the active rotor idles.
5. After the DC power supply is turned on, an electromagnetic field is generated, and the magnetic powder of the working medium forms a magnetic powder chain under the action of the magnetic force line, and the inner rotor and the outer rotor are coupled to achieve transmission and braking torque.
